PhistucK is correct, but he points out a very useful tip which can be used to solve your problem:
Since you can keep existing New Tab Page thumbnails with the "pin page", you can pin your NTP with the thumbnails of the pages you have visited and you want to keep. That is effectively "choosing which thumbnails" to show on the NTP. The important point is that you must visit at least once any page you wish to show the thumbnail for on the NTP. The best way to do this is to type or copy-and-paste the entire URL you wish to go to into the Omnibox and hit <return>. (This is because of bug http://crbug.com/9700 which doesn't populate the NTP as quickly if you only go to new pages by clicking hyperlinks on existing pages.) Of course, this is harder if you have used Chrome alot and have visited many pages and your current NTP thumbnails are not the ones you wish to show. In such case, one option is to keep clicking "remove page" for thumbnails you don't want until you get to the thumbnails you do want and then pin that. Another option is to "Clear Browsing History" from Wrench menu > Options > Personal Stuff > Clear Browsing Data (or Ctrl+Shift+Del). Clearing your browsing history will remove all thumbnails from the NTP and then you can repopulate from scratch and then pin those thumbnails you wish to keep.
